what is the length of side a? triangle image with hypotenuse 15, base 9, right angle, side a vertical select the best answer

Explanation:

Step1: Identify the triangle type

The triangle is a right triangle (has a right angle). We can use the Pythagorean theorem: \(a^{2}+b^{2}=c^{2}\), where \(c\) is the hypotenuse, and \(a\), \(b\) are the legs. Here, hypotenuse \(c = 15\), one leg \(b = 9\), and we need to find \(a\).

Step2: Apply the Pythagorean theorem

Rearrange the formula to solve for \(a\): \(a=\sqrt{c^{2}-b^{2}}\). Substitute \(c = 15\) and \(b = 9\) into the formula: \(a=\sqrt{15^{2}-9^{2}}=\sqrt{225 - 81}=\sqrt{144}\).

Step3: Calculate the square root

\(\sqrt{144}=12\).

Answer:

12
